The 2026 French Interclub Championships N1 concluded this weekend at the Palatium in Troyes. After several days of intense competition, the final rankings for men and women are now known.
Final Men's Standings – Interclubs N1 2026
- Casa Padel Uno
- Big padel
- Sète Padel
- All In Padel 69
- All In Padel Sports Arena
- La Bandeja
- Padel Touch Bassin d'Arcachon
- Padel Horizon
- My Center Palavas
- Padel Campus Arena
- Toulouse Padel -
- Tops of Nîmes Padel -
- Mind Padel -
- TC des Loges Saint-Germain-en-Laye
- Padel Shot Saint-Etienne
- Padel Club Agen
Final Women's Standings – Interclub N1 2026
- TC Bandol
- Big padel
- Stade Toulousain Tennis Padel
- My Center Palavas
- TC Nice Giordan
- Caen Padel Shot
- Chambéry TC
- Padel Mas Club
Established champions and a historic first title
At the gentlemen, Casa Padel Uno picks up his second French Interclub Championship title, after the one won in 2024. The Parisian club, the favorite on paper, lived up to expectations, though not without a scare in the final against a Big padel Very catchy, yet another unfortunate finalist.
At the Women, TC Bandol secures its first historic titleAs the number 1 seed, the Var club confirmed its status after an extremely tense final against Big PadelThe ambitious recruitment carried out this season has paid off.
Relegations to National 2
At the end of this 2026 edition, the last two men's teams and one women's team are relegated to National 2 :
- Men :
- Padel Shot Saint-Etienne
- Padel Club Agen
- Women :
- Padel Mas Club
Note
In the men's category, the impressive performance of All In Padel 69who finished 4th after a solid tournament, as well as confirming Sète Padel, still present at the top of the table after its title in 2025.
In the ladies, Big padel secured a podium finish immediately after his promotion to National 1, a very impressive performance, while the Stade Toulousain climbs onto the podium.
